I don't have a cd burner, so how can I get apt-get install to see the iso
images as install sources without burning the images to discs?

The quick-and-nasty way: when apt asks for the cd to be inserted in /cdrom/, before you press return, switch to another VC and symlink /dev/cdrom to the
iso mount point.
